How does the 115 MPH V-ult wind load rating impact fence design?
The V-ult (ultimate wind speed) of 115 MPH, per ASCE 7-22 standards, dictates structural design. This rating requires closer post spacing, deeper footings, and wind-rated tension brackets to resist peak storm season gusts, especially in exposed areas near the Northern State Parkway.
What is the utility locate process before digging fence post holes?
New York 811 must be contacted at least two business days before excavation. Hitting a gas, water, or fiber line in Kensington Village is a major liability event that incurs repair costs and fines. A professional contractor manages this call and all associated permit office paperwork for the project.

How does the 42-inch frost line in New York affect fence post footings?
Frost heave is a primary failure mode in Kensington Village. The International Residential Code (IRC) requires footings to extend below the frost line. Posts set above 42 inches will lift during freeze-thaw cycles, compromising fence integrity. Proper concrete footings below this depth prevent shifting.
How do Kensington's moderate termite risk and soil corrosivity influence material choice?
Material compatibility is critical. Pressure-treated lumber must be rated for ground contact to resist termites. For metal posts or fasteners in moderate-corrosion soil, hot-dip galvanized or stainless steel hardware is mandatory to prevent unsightly rust streaks and premature failure.

How do smart gates integrate with New York's pool safety code?
NYS Uniform Code 19 NYCRR Part 1220 requires self-closing, self-latching gates for pool enclosures. Modern smart-gate IoT systems provide this function and create an access log, meeting the 2026 standard for documented compliance and liability protection for New York homeowners.
